Animal proteins were mixed for Tuesday, with unsettled undertones present in poultry items. Communication of a have-have-not spread has led to irregular ranges on all regions for poultry-by and chicken meal. Supportive tones were indicated due to short offering at some locations; however, poultry-by pet grade and chicken meal had limited trade for the day. A high of $1200/st was reported on Mid-South chicken meal in light volume while both Southeast and Mid-South poultry-by pet grade had a high of $1100/st reported, in reduced capacity. With supportive tones and higher values, the Mid-South and Southeast poultry-by pet grade, as well as Mid-South chicken meal markets, were adjusted higher from the previously set ranges.

Other items on the animal protein bulletin were flat for the day, though undertones of pressure were communicated on ruminant meat and bonemeal. Some contacts indicated prices dropped $5-$10/st, but this could not be confirmed for the bulk of trade by press…
